软考高级考试分几门课及其考试内容概述

软考,全称为计算机技术与软件专业技术资格(水平)考试,是由国家人力资源和社会保障部组织的一项对计算机专业技术人才的职业资格考试。考试分为初、中、高三个等级,其中高级考试是对考生在计算机软件领域的高级技能和知识的检验。本文将详细介绍软考高级考试的课程设置以及考试内容。

一、软考高级考试课程设置

软考高级考试主要分为三个科目,分别是综合知识、案例分析和论文。这三个科目涵盖了考生在计算机软件领域应知应会的知识点和技能,以及对其应用能力的考查。

1. 综合知识:这一科目主要考查考生对计算机软件领域的基础理论、基本知识、基本技能和基本方法的掌握程度。具体内容包括但不限于软件工程、软件过程改进、计算机系统结构、操作系统、数据库系统、计算机网络、信息安全、信息化与信息系统等。
2. 案例分析:案例分析科目主要考查考生运用所学知识和方法解决实际问题的能力。考试中,考生需要分析给定的案例,识别问题、提出解决方案并进行评价。这一科目要求考生具备较强的逻辑思维能力和实践能力。
3. 论文:论文科目是考查考生综合运用所学知识和方法,独立分析和解决问题的能力以及文字表达能力的重要环节。考生需要根据所给的主题和要求,撰写一篇具有学术价值的论文。论文的主题通常与计算机软件领域的前沿技术或热点问题相关。

二、软考高级考试内容概述

软考高级考试的内容广泛而深入,要求考生具备扎实的计算机软件领域基础理论知识和丰富的实践经验。考试重点关注考生在软件工程、系统分析与设计、软件开发与测试、项目管理等方面的能力和素养。以下是软考高级考试内容的概述:

1. 软件工程:软件工程是软考高级考试的重要内容之一,主要考查考生对软件开发过程、方法和技术的理解和掌握程度。包括软件需求工程、软件设计、软件测试与维护等方面的知识点。

2. 系统分析与设计:这部分内容主要考查考生对计算机系统分析与设计方法和技术的掌握情况,包括系统规划、需求分析、系统设计(包括体系结构设计、数据库设计、用户界面设计等)等方面的知识点。
3. 软件开发与测试:软考高级考试对软件开发与测试方面的知识和技能要求较高,主要考查考生对编程语言、开发环境、开发框架以及软件测试方法和技术等方面的掌握情况。
4. 项目管理:项目管理是软考高级考试的重要考点之一,主要考查考生在项目管理理论、方法和技术方面的掌握情况,包括项目计划制定、项目监控与控制、项目风险管理等方面的知识点。
5. 法律法规与标准:软考高级考试还要求考生对计算机软件领域的法律法规、行业标准和职业道德等方面的内容有所了解,以确保考生在从事相关工作时能够遵守相关法规和标准。
6. 前沿技术与发展趋势:为了体现考试的先进性和时效性,软考高级考试还会涉及计算机软件领域的前沿技术和发展趋势,要求考生关注行业动态,保持对新技术的学习和探索精神。

总之,软考高级考试是对考生在计算机软件领域综合能力和素养的全面检验。通过深入学习和实践,考生可以不断提升自己的专业技能水平,为我国的计算机软件产业发展做出贡献。